
Port Vale Consider Move For Sunderland Keeper Blondy Nna Noukeu
Sunderland are weighing up whether to let goalkeeper Blondy Nna Noukeu leave in January, with Port Vale and Belgian side Sint-Truiden linked with a move, as reported by the Sunderland Echo.
The 24-year-old joined Sunderland in August 2024 but has yet to feature for the first team, playing instead for the under-21s.
Nna Noukeu came through the academy at Royal Excel Mouscron before joining Stoke City in 2019, taking in loan spells at Crawley Town and Southend United.
His lack of senior opportunities on Wearside has opened the door to a possible loan or permanent exit, with an estimated market value of around €150,000 making him an affordable target for clubs seeking a young keeper with experience in English football.
